Post A Patch is a community project in which people from around the globe knit/crochet patches and send them to us. We then make these patches into beautiful blankets and donate them to charity.


Blankets not only keep us nice & cosy, they make us feel safe & loved. No matter who you are, where you are, or what your circumstances, these are two of the most important things to feel, we think. So we aim to gift these colourful handmade blankets to people in need, to give them a little hope and a big woolly hug.

We will be donating some of our blankets to The Lighthouse Foundation, a charity that strives to end youth homelessness. These blankets will wing their way to their Mums and Bubs home, a place where young homeless girls and their babies can find safety and care.


St Kilda Mums will also receive blanket donations from us. They are a charity that works closely with local social service agencies to find and collect baby items to pass onto and help families in need across Victoria.
